Escape Behavior
Actions taken to avoid expected or current discomforts, often seen in both human psychological responses and animal behavior studies.
Shaping Behavior
The process of reinforcing successive approximations of a desired behavior to teach a new behavior or skill.
Negative Punishment
A decrease in behavior that results from a removed consequence.
Skinnerian Principles
Behavioral principles based on the work of B.F. Skinner, emphasizing the effects of reinforcement and punishment on behavior.
